On November 8, 2001, pursuant to a guilty plea to Possession With Intent to Distribute Cocaine and Aiding and Abetting and Use and Carry a Firearm During a Drug Trafficking Offense, Luciano Abreu Gonzalez appeared in United States District Court for the Eastern District ofNorth Carolina, and was sentenced to 168 months imprisonment to be followed by 5 years supervised release. . .

The defendant was released from custody on June 28, 2013, and began supervision in the Eastern District of North Carolina.

He has performed satisfactorily on supervision. He has submitted to DNA testing, all drug tests have been negative, and he has been on low intensity supervision since October 2016. His ten.TI of supervised release is set to expire on June 27, 2018. · The probation office is requesting early termination in this case. The U.S.Attomey's Office has •been contacted and AUSA Ontjes has no objections to this request. Please indicate the court's ·preference by marking the appropriate selection below. /
